MFC 應用程式精靈
MFC 應用程式精靈產生的應用程式可於編譯時實作 Windows 可執行檔 (.exe) 應用程式的基本功能。 MFC 起始應用程式包括 C++ 來源檔 (.cpp)、資源檔 (.rc)、標題檔 (.h) 以及專案檔 (.vcxproj)。 起始檔案 (Starter File) 中所產生的程式碼是以 MFC 為基礎。
注意事項 |
---|
根據所選取的選項,精靈會在專案中建立額外的檔案。 例如,您在進階功能頁面中選取 [即時線上說明],精靈就會建立編譯專案說明檔時必要的檔案。 如需精靈建立檔案的詳細資訊,請參閱為 Visual C++ 專案建立的檔案類型,並參閱專案中的 Readme.txt 檔案。 |
概觀
本精靈頁面說明目前正在建立的 MFC 應用程式之應用程式設定。 在預設情況下,精靈會如下建立專案:
-
專案建立為具有索引標籤式多重文件介面 (MDI) 支援。 如需詳細資訊,請參閱SDI and MDI。
這個專案使用Document/View Architecture。
專案使用 Unicode 程式庫。
專案是使用 Visual Studio 專案樣式建立,會啟用視覺化樣式切換。
專案在共用 DLL 使用 MFC。 如需詳細資訊,請參閱DLL。
-
- 專案不提供複合文件支援。
-
- 專案會使用專案名稱做為預設的文件樣板字串。
-
- 專案不提供資料庫支援。
-
- 專案實作標準 Windows 使用者介面功能,例如系統功能表、狀態列、最大化和最小化方塊、[關於] 方塊、標準功能表列和停駐工具列,以及子框架。
-
專案支援列印和預覽列印。
專案支援 ActiveX 控制項。 如需詳細資訊,請參閱Sequence of Operations for Creating ActiveX Controls。
專案不支援 Automation、MAPI、Windows Sockets 或 Active Accessibility。
專案支援 [總管停駐窗格]、[輸出停駐窗格] 和 [屬性停駐窗格]。
-
專案的檢視類別是衍生自 CView Class。
專案的應用程式類別是衍生自 CWinAppEx Class。
專案的文件類別是衍生自 CDocument Class。
專案的主框架類別是衍生自 CMDIFrameWndEx Class。
專案的子框架類別是衍生自 CMDIChildWndEx Class。
若要變更這些預設值,請按一下精靈左欄中的適當索引標籤標題,並於出現的頁面上進行變更。
在您建立 MFC 應用程式專案後,可使用 Visual C++ 程式碼精靈在專案中加入物件或控制項。
請參閱
工作
概念
Using the Classes to Write Applications for Windows